Darkwood – PC
In most games you are placed in a position of importance and power. Darkwood is a game that treats you like the scared frail creature that you are. Filled with surrealist horrors and strange clues. Are you brave enough to piece them together?

Alone in the Dark – 3DO
Alone in the Dark is often considered the grandfather of the survival/horror genre. And this is before Resident Evil was even born! Originally one could only find this masterpiece of a game on the 3DO. Spooky, huh?
